In Reply to: Flushing sprayer posted by Donaldinky on July 11, 2013 at 15:21:44:
We use to use "aqueous ammonia" Just a real strong ammonia, had to get it at a chemical supply place. sounds like regular ammonia would work as well. We also added a little surfactant to the mix.
I did this on 400 gallon saddle tanks and never had any problems. Ran the pump and circulated it through the whole system.
I also kept an old broom and swept the inside of the tanks (as best I could reach) to get off any residual, but we were still using some wettable powders back then and it would settle out some.
